Robert Martin - Foto, biografia, vida personal, notícies, programador, llibres 2021

Anonim

Biografia

Robert Martin és un enginyer de programador, que també fama sota el sobrenom de l'oncle Bob. Des de principis dels anys setanta, American s'ha convertit en un desenvolupador de programari professional (programari) i als anys 90 va rebre l'estat d'un consultor internacional en aquesta àrea. L'instructor es dedicava a una zona de programació extrema. Ara el llibre de l'autor té una gran demanda.

Infància i joventut

Sobre els anys infantils i adolescents de la biografia de l'enginyer sap petites fets. L'escriptor va néixer el 5 de desembre de 1952 als Estats Units. El seu nom complet és Robert Cecil Martin. Des de molt jove, li agradava les informàtiques, vaig intentar escriure programes.

Vida personal

Sobre la vida personal del consultor també és molt poca informació. El programador prefereix no compartir amb els detalls de premsa d'aquest tipus. A les xarxes socials - "Instagram", "Twitter": no posa fotos que llancessin la llum si Martin està casada. L'atenció de Robert es concentra en el treball, desenvolupant i escrivint llibres.

L'enginyer té el seu propi lloc.

Programació i llibres

A principis dels anys 90, l'American va fundar l'objecte Mentor, en el qual els instructors es van dur a terme a C ++, Java, plantilles de disseny d'edificis, UML, així com en metodologies extremes de programació.

Els autors d'aquest tipus de programes d'escriptura es van convertir en Kent Beck, Ward Cunningham i altres investigadors. El concepte de la metodologia era el següent. Els científics han volgut aplicar mètodes i pràctiques de desenvolupament de programari útils per a un nou nivell "extrem".

Per exemple, abans de dur a terme una auditoria del codi, un programador es va dedicar a una auditoria directa del Codi escrit pel segon desenvolupador. La versió "extrema" d'aquesta pràctica va dictar la necessitat de "programació de parells". En aquest cas, un empleat es dedicava a escriure el codi, el segon va mirar simultàniament el material que només va ser creat pel seu col·lega.

El 1995, la primera obra de l'escriptor "desenvolupant aplicacions orientades a objectes a C ++ utilitzant el mètode Bucha es va publicar a Prentice-Hall, el Servei d'Edició Americana, especialitzada en els llibres de temes educatius.

De 1996 a 1999, Martin va servir com a editor en cap de la revista Informe C ++. El 2002, hi va haver una nova obra de l'investigador "Desenvolupament ràpid de programes". Principis, exemples, pràctica ". En aquesta edició es van repetir temes plantejats en el primer llibre de l'autor i es van revelar nous consells útils sobre el disseny i el desenvolupament orientat a objectes en equips àgils.

Els llibres fabricats pels nord-americans van trobar ràpidament un cercle de lectors i van guanyar popularitat no només als estats, sinó també en altres països. El 2007, l'autor va agradar al públic amb l'obra "Principis, patrons i mètodes de desenvolupament flexible en C #". Martin va intentar recollir material teòric sobre el tema i també va revelar aspectes de l'aplicació pràctica del desenvolupament flexible.

També aborda els mètodes de refactorització i mètodes d'ús productiu de tipus de diagrames UML. Es mostren els exemples de les tasques establertes, quines eroshes i accions falses es poden permetre durant les solucions, i es donen indicacions com evitar-ho.

El 2008, la bibliografia de l'escriptor es va reposar amb nova creació - Treball titulat "Codi net. Creació, anàlisi i refactorització. " L'enviament principal és la programació competent. En la publicació, Robert va destacar que fins i tot el codi de programa feta de forma rudal és capaç de treballar. No obstant això, el codi "brut" requereix recursos addicionals de l'empresa del desenvolupador.

Robert Martin - Foto, biografia, vida personal, notícies, programador, llibres 2021 4595_1

Per tant, és important aprendre a crear immediatament un "producte" sense taques, i com fer-ho, explica al llibre. Aquí l'autor va liderar molts exemples, va esbossar els principis i tècniques per escriure i netejar el codi, desenvolupats escenaris pràctics de la complexitat creixent.

El 2011, el següent best-seller del científic "es va publicar el programador perfecte. Com es convertirà en un professional de desenvolupament de programari. " En el treball, l'americà considera qüestions relacionades amb el calendari de treball del creador de programes, amb les parts negatives de l'estat de flux, amb la utilitat de la programació de parell i grup.

Alguns temes d'aquest treball es van desenvolupar en el llibre 2017 "Arquitectura neta. Art de desenvolupament de programari. La publicació està dirigida a desenvolupadors, analistes, arquitectes i altres treballadors de programació.

Robert Martin ara

El 2020, l'investigador continua participant en conferències i classes magistrals sobre el tema del programari. A "Instagram" seguidors de les idees americanes disposen de fotos d'aquests esdeveniments. També el consultor escriu articles en periòdiques.

Bibliografia

  • 1995 - "Desenvolupament d'aplicacions orientades a objectes a C ++ mitjançant el mètode Bucha"
  • 2002 - "Desenvolupament ràpid del programa. Principis, exemples, pràctica "
  • 2007 - "Principis, patrons i mètodes de desenvolupament flexible en C #"
  • 2008 - "Codi net. Creació, anàlisi i refactorització "
  • 2011 - "El programador perfecte. Com es convertirà en un professional de desenvolupament professional
  • 2017 - "Arquitectura neta. Art de desenvolupament de programari
  • 2019 - "Desenvolupament net: tornar als conceptes bàsics"

Llegeix més